Ryder means “mounted warrior”, “horseman”, “messenger on horseback” (from Old English “ridere” = to ride a horse-mounted warrior/messenger). Pronunciation of … WebRyder gained the most popularity as a baby name in 2009, when it's usage went up by 144.85%. During this year, 2718 babies were named Ryder, which was 0.0717% of the baby boys born in the USA that year. The most the names popularity ever grew to was 0.113%, in this year alone more than 4000 boys were named Ryder. In the U.S., it made its appearance in … score systems limitedWebThe name Ryder is of Old English origin and means "horsemen" or "cavalrymen, messenger." It was originally used a surname, but became a popular given name in the 20th century. Ryder is derived from the Old English ridere, meaning "mounted warrior."
